Color Coordination

Color coordination is a crucial aspect of achieving a well-dressed appearance. It involves selecting colors that complement each other and create a harmonious look. The key to successful color coordination is to understand the color wheel and the principles of color theory.

The color wheel is a circular diagram that displays different colors and their relationships to one another. It consists of three primary colors: red, blue, and yellow, which can be mixed to create secondary colors: green, purple, and orange. The tertiary colors are created by mixing primary and secondary colors, resulting in colors like blue-green, red-purple, and yellow-orange.

To achieve a well-coordinated look, it’s essential to understand the color principles, such as complementary, analogous, and monochromatic colors.

  • Complementary colors are those that are opposite each other on the color wheel, such as blue and orange or red and green. These colors create a high-contrast look and can be used together to make a statement.
  • Analogous colors are next to each other on the color wheel, such as blue, blue-green, and green. These colors create a harmonious look and can be used together to create a serene and calming effect.
  • Monochromatic colors are different shades of the same color, such as light blue, navy blue, and black. These colors create a cohesive look and can be used together to create a sophisticated and polished appearance.

In addition to understanding color theory, it’s also important to consider the occasion and personal style when selecting colors. For example, bold and bright colors may be more appropriate for a casual setting, while muted and subtle colors may be more suitable for a formal event.

In conclusion, color coordination is a vital aspect of achieving a well-dressed appearance. By understanding the color wheel, color principles, and considering the occasion and personal style, one can create a harmonious and cohesive look that exudes confidence and sophistication.

Neatness and Polished Details

Neatness and polished details are essential components of a well-dressed appearance. A person who pays attention to these elements is often perceived as more put-together, confident, and successful. Here are some specific ways to achieve neatness and polished details in your attire:

  • Ironing and Steaming: Clothing that is properly ironed or steamed appears more polished and professional. This includes items such as dress shirts, slacks, and suits. Ironing removes wrinkles and creases, while steaming helps to relax the fibers and remove any underlying wrinkles.
  • Tailoring: A well-fitted garment can make a significant difference in the overall appearance of an outfit. Tailoring can include alterations such as taking in or letting out seams, adjusting sleeve lengths, and modifying the waistline. It is essential to have a good understanding of one’s body shape and proportions to ensure that clothing fits well.
  • Shoe Care: Shoes that are clean, polished, and in good condition can elevate an entire outfit. It is important to regularly clean and condition leather shoes, and to repair any damage or wear and tear. For suede shoes, a suede brush can be used to gently brush away any dirt or debris.
  • Accessories: The right accessories can add a touch of polish to an outfit. This includes items such as belts, hats, scarves, and jewelry. It is important to choose accessories that complement the overall look and style of the outfit.
  • Hair and Grooming: A well-groomed appearance also includes paying attention to hair and grooming. This includes keeping hair styled and neat, trimming excess hair, and maintaining a clean-shaven or well-groomed beard. For men, a simple comb or brush can be used to style hair, while a razor and shaving cream can be used to maintain a clean shave.

By focusing on these key elements of neatness and polished details, one can create a well-dressed appearance that exudes confidence and success.

Accessorizing Appropriately

Accessorizing is an essential aspect of dressing well, as it can elevate an outfit from ordinary to extraordinary. Here are some key tips for accessorizing appropriately:

  1. Balance: Accessorizing should complement, not overpower, the overall look. Balance is key to creating a harmonious outfit. For example, a statement necklace can add flair to a simple white t-shirt and jeans.
  2. Proportion: Consider the proportions of the accessory in relation to the rest of the outfit. A small pendant on a long chain, for instance, might look out of place with a voluminous sweater.
  3. Consistency: When selecting accessories, choose items that are consistent with the overall style of the outfit. For example, pairing a classic watch with a casual outfit may not work as well as pairing it with a formal ensemble.
  4. Quality: Invest in high-quality accessories that will last. While trends come and go, timeless pieces like a leather handbag or a diamond studded bracelet will always be in style.
  5. Functionality: Choose accessories that serve a purpose or have a special meaning. A practical bag, for example, can be both functional and stylish. A charm bracelet can tell a story about the wearer’s life experiences.
  6. Cohesion: When selecting accessories, aim for a cohesive look. A coordinated set of accessories can tie an outfit together, such as a matching necklace and earring set or a bracelet and ring set.
  7. Occasion: Consider the occasion when selecting accessories. A black-tie event may call for diamonds and pearls, while a casual beach day may require a straw hat and sunglasses.
  8. Color: Match or contrast the color of the accessory with the color of the outfit. For example, a silver bracelet can complement a black dress, while a colorful scarf can add a pop of color to a neutral outfit.
  9. Personal Style: Accessorizing should reflect your personal style. Don’t be afraid to experiment with different accessories and find what works best for you. A bold personality may require bold accessories, while a more subtle personality may prefer delicate pieces.
  10. Layering: Layering accessories can add depth and dimension to an outfit. Mix and match necklaces, bracelets, and rings for a unique and polished look.

By following these tips, you can master the art of accessorizing and create a well-dressed appearance that is both stylish and sophisticated.
